Influence Of Forage Diversity And Condensed Tannins On Livestock Foraging Behavior, Production And Environmental Impact, Sebastian P. Lagrange Aug 2020

Influence Of Forage Diversity And Condensed Tannins On Livestock Foraging Behavior, Production And Environmental Impact, Sebastian P. Lagrange

All Graduate Theses and Dissertations, Spring 1920 to Summer 2023

Eating a combination of forages with different chemistries (i.e., nutrients, beneficial compounds such as tannins) may enhance ruminant nutrition and reduce environmental impacts relative to eating single forages. I explored the influence of offering sheep and cattle all possible combinations of tanniferous (i.e., plants with tannins; birdsfoot trefoil, sainfoin) and non-tanniferous legumes (i.e., plants without tannins; alfalfa) or their monocultures on animal performance, behavior, and methane and nitrogen (N) emissions. Offering choices among these legumes to penned sheep improved intake and diet digestibility relative to feeding monocultures. Effect Of Bacterial Inoculant On Alfalfa Haylage: Ensiling Characteristics And Milk Production Response When Fed To Dairy Cows In Early Lactation, Barb Kent May 1988

Effect Of Bacterial Inoculant On Alfalfa Haylage: Ensiling Characteristics And Milk Production Response When Fed To Dairy Cows In Early Lactation, Barb Kent

All Graduate Theses and Dissertations, Spring 1920 to Summer 2023

Third-cutting alfalfa hay harvested at bud stage in each of 2 yrs, treated with a live bacterial inoculant, packed in polyethylene-bonded bags and allowed to ensile. In both years, treated haylage had a lower pH, and a period effect was found for pH and mold count, regardless of treatment. In year 1, there was a period effect found for acid detergent fiber. In year 2, mean lactic-acid-producing bacteria numbers (log 10) were significantly higher for treated haylage (9.69 and 10.36) for control and treated haylage, respectively). Regardless of treatment, lactic-acid-producing bacteria numbers and water soluble carbohydrates significantly declined through time. …

The Effect Of Rain Leaching On Field Dried Alfalfa Hay Yield And Lamb Production From The Hay, John M. Kaykay May 1982

The Effect Of Rain Leaching On Field Dried Alfalfa Hay Yield And Lamb Production From The Hay, John M. Kaykay

All Graduate Theses and Dissertations, Spring 1920 to Summer 2023

A 2 x 3 x 2 factorial arranged split plot experiment was used to determine the decrease of dry matter yield from field-dried alfalfa hay caused by the application of a measured quantity of artificial rain (sprinkling irrigation). The three hay treatment factors were (1) alfalfa hay was cut at late vegetative and early bloom stage of maturity and (2) leached by 0, 5 mm or 20 mm of artificial rain applied by sprinkling and (3) sprinkled in the swath, 24 or 48 hours after cutting.

Changes in dry matter yield were not significantly (P < .05) related to stage of maturity of forage, level of artificial rain applied or the time of application of artificial rain. There were no significant interactions for dry matter yield. The non-significant results were probably due to the variability of the alfalfa stand among the specific areas harvested for each treatment and insufficient replications to control the variability.

The Effect Of Ddt Residue On The Composition And Digestibility Of Alfalfa Hay, Than Myint May 1948

The Effect Of Ddt Residue On The Composition And Digestibility Of Alfalfa Hay, Than Myint

All Graduate Theses and Dissertations, Spring 1920 to Summer 2023

DDT (2,2 bis (p-chlorophenyl) 1,1,1-trichloroethane) was first synthesized in 1874 by Seidler in Switzerland, however, its effectiveness as an insecticide was not known until about 1942. The active principle was first known as G.H.B. (Gesarol-Neccid Base): but in 1943 DDT was suggested as an abbreviation for Dichlore Diphenyl Trichloroethane (Kaaegie, 1946). In fact DDT, as a powerful insecticide is one of the developments made during World War II.
